General carpentry services encompass a wide range of woodworking and structural work that helps maintain, repair, or improve residential properties. These services typically include tasks such as installing or repairing doors, windows, cabinets, and shelving, as well as framing walls, building custom furniture, and performing trim and molding work. Skilled carpenters work with various materials to ensure that structural components are sound and that finished elements meet both aesthetic and functional needs. Homeowners often turn to general carpentry to address issues that affect the safety, appearance, or usability of their living spaces.
Many common problems can be addressed through general carpentry services. For example, warped or damaged doors and windows can compromise security and energy efficiency, while loose or broken cabinets can hinder organization and daily routines. Structural issues, such as sagging floors or unstable framing, may require expert repairs to ensure the stability of the property. Additionally, homeowners looking to upgrade or customize their interiors often utilize carpentry services to create built-in storage, entertainment centers, or decorative features that enhance the overall look and functionality of their homes.

The overview below groups typical General Carpentry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Basic carpentry repairs like fixing a door frame or replacing trim typically cost between $150 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the scope and materials involved.
Medium Projects - Installing shelves, building custom cabinets, or repairing larger sections usually range from $600 to $2,000. These projects are common and can vary based on complexity and size.
Major Renovations - Significant carpentry work such as room additions or extensive remodeling can cost from $2,000 to $5,000 or more. Larger, more complex projects tend to push into the higher end of this range.
Full Replacement - Replacing entire structures like doors, window casings, or framing can start around $1,000 and go well above $5,000 for full-scale replacements. Many projects fall into the middle tiers, with fewer reaching the highest cost levels.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
